Transaction 21ca62833c55647f75431952b1a3822c6c2b3c3179966b483e4a46bd92723236
1 Input
2 Outputs
- 21ca62833c55647f75431952b1a3822c6c2b3c3179966b483e4a46bd92723236:0
- 21ca62833c55647f75431952b1a3822c6c2b3c3179966b483e4a46bd92723236:1
value 41135000
address 36ibys2LDbEDKudSwTHPVnfECn3RiBNdgS
value 43757100
address 15DULyfsRTzVH9P3ScmHz71SNEDCYH9ukK